Arsenal Monitoring Leon Goretzka’s Contract Situation

Arsenal is closely monitoring the contract status of Leon Goretzka, as the midfielder is emerging as a viable option for a free transfer in the upcoming summer transfer window.

According to the Daily Mirror, the Gunners are among several teams considering the signing of the Bayern Munich player, whose current contract is set to expire in June.

Bayern’s Position on Retaining Goretzka

Given that Bayern Munich is still in contention for multiple titles and lacks depth in experienced midfielders, the club is committed to retaining Goretzka at least until the end of the current season.

However, this position may change once the season wraps up.

Goretzka’s Experience and Achievements

Now at the age of 31, Goretzka is recognized as one of the more seasoned midfielders across European football. His tenure at Bayern has seen him accumulate an impressive collection of trophies, including several Bundesliga titles and a Champions League victory. He has built a reputation for his physicality, clever positioning, and ability to score from midfield.

Despite facing stiffer competition for a place in recent seasons, he has consistently risen to the occasion, particularly in crucial matches.

Arsenal’s Need for Experienced Leadership

Under Mikel Arteta’s guidance, Arsenal has developed a youthful and dynamic squad. There is an increasing understanding that adding experienced leadership could be crucial as they strive to maintain their title challenges and make a deep run in European competitions.

Goretzka’s Interest in the Premier League

Clubs in Italy, including Napoli and Juventus, are reportedly keeping an eye on Goretzka’s situation, recognizing that a free transfer presents a rare opportunity to acquire a player of his caliber without incurring a transfer fee.

Nonetheless, reports indicate that Goretzka is keen to explore the Premier League before the later stages of his career. This ambition may play into Arsenal’s hands, especially in light of their notable resurgence and clear strategic vision.
